Critical Role Adds D&D Designers‍ to Expand Tabletop game Role

Updated June 16, 2025

Critical Role Productions, known ‍for its Dungeons & Dragons web series, is broadening its reach in tabletop games with ⁢the addition of Chris perkins and Jeremy Crawford. Both Perkins and‍ Crawford ‍previously spearheaded the Dungeons & Dragons‍ design team‍ at ⁤Wizards of the Coast.

Perkins served ​as creative director, guiding the story ‍direction,⁤ while Crawford was⁤ the game director, overseeing the rules.Their move to Critical Role’s Darrington Press division⁤ marks a significant ‍step for the company.

Travis Willingham,‌ CEO of Darrington⁢ Press, emphasized⁣ the ‌impact of these hires. He noted the experience Perkins and Crawford bring will elevate the company’s ‍game development.

They ​are ​two⁣ of the biggest names … that​ have influenced TTRPGs and the games that we‌ played.

— Darrington Press‌ CEO Travis Willingham‍ on Perkins and Crawford

Perkins said⁤ the opportunity to work with Crawford and the‌ Critical Role team drew him out of‍ retirement. Crawford added that after ‍18 years with D&D, he was ready ​for a new adventure, and joining Critical​ Role felt like “coming home.”

Both Perkins and Crawford highlighted the importance of diversity and introductory experiences in growing the tabletop gaming community.⁢ They aim ⁣to foster a welcoming environment for new ‌generations ‍of gamers.

What’s next

perkins hinted at new ideas​ already⁤ in​ development for Darrington Press, ⁢though specific details ‍remain under wraps. the duo’s focus will⁤ be on expanding the company’s⁣ role in⁣ creating engaging and‌ inclusive⁣ tabletop gaming experiences.
